My least favorite would have to be Thrall. He was somewhat cool in WarCraft 3, but he's just been a coward in WoW. Always kowtowing to the Alliance, denying his Orcish roots / just picking and choosing the parts of his Orcish roots that he liked. Plus Garrosh's entire arc was Thrall failing. He dragged this Orc from Outland to Azeroth, filled his head with stories about how great his father was (Nevermind that for most of his life his father was kind of a dickhead, willingly drank the demon koolaid TWICE.) and then put him in charge and didn't give him any guidance. Then when Garrosh went and did Orc things the Orc way Thrall confronted him only to get absolutely smacked around and schooled on what it means to be an Orc. Post beatdown Thrall runs away so the player characters can deal with Garrosh and then sneaks back in to try to get a killing blow. (See cinematic.) - Then, he still gets absolutely trucked by a weakened Garrosh in AU Draenor. Oh and now the elements have abandoned him. Hopefully we don't see much (any?) more of him after BfA.
